Why This Still Matters (Apparently)
YouTube is great for watching videos, but sometimes you just want the audio — say, your favourite podcast episode, that killer guitar solo, or some obscure indie track that’s nowhere else online. Downloading the video itself is a pain (and takes up space), so converting to MP3 feels like the logical step.
But here’s the catch: YouTube compresses audio pretty heavily to save bandwidth, so the original sound isn’t exactly pristine. When you “convert” a YouTube video to MP3, you’re basically re-encoding a compressed file. That’s like photocopying a photocopy — sound quality usually takes a hit.
So the big question is: How do you do this without losing sound quality? Well, spoiler alert, you kinda can’t get better quality than what YouTube gives you. What you can do is avoid making it worse than it already is.

But Wait, What About Sound Quality? Seriously, How Do You Not Lose It?
Okay, not to sound like a broken record, but the truth is: YouTube’s audio is already compressed using lossy codecs like AAC at around 128-256 kbps depending on the video. So, when you convert to MP3, you’re just re-encoding a compressed file — it’s like trying to squeeze water from a stone.

Here’s the deal: YouTube’s terms of service explicitly forbid the downloading of content unless there’s a download button provided (which there usually isn’t, unless you’re using YouTube Premium). So, technically, using an MP3 converter to download audio from YouTube videos is against their rules. But is it “illegal”? That’s a bit more complicated.
The Legal Bit (Or Why You Should Pretend To Care)
Here’s where it starts to get murky — and honestly, a bit of a yawner. The legality depends on where you live, what you download, and what you do with it.
- Copyright Laws Vary: In the UK, for example, ripping audio from YouTube videos can be considered copyright infringement if you don’t have the creator’s permission. The same applies pretty much everywhere with decent copyright laws.
- Personal Use vs. Distribution: It’s often argued that if you’re downloading for personal use only (like, no sharing or selling), you might be in a grey area. But grey areas are slippery slopes, mate.
- Fair Use? In the US, there’s “fair use,” but it rarely covers downloading complete songs without permission. So, don’t quote me on that if you’re planning to make a business out of it.
Honestly, the safest bet is to assume it’s not strictly legal to use YouTube MP3 converter downloads for anything other than, maybe, private experiments. But again, who’s policing your weekend playlist?
